Arthur Andrew Blomquist

Blomquist, Arthur Andrew 80, loving husband, stepfather, grandfather, uncle, loyal friend to many, passed away peacefully after a heroic battle with Alzheim- er's on Jan. 12, 2013. Born in Mpls, Feb. 25, 1932, Art was a kind, gentle soul, easily sharing his love without question. In Art's early years, he delighted in keeping physically active, a Boy Scout for many years. He was an accomplished sailor. He loved water & down-hill skiing. Art graduated Roosevelt High School, was in the Naval Reserve for 8 years and took up printing at Jones Press, which led him to his 28-year career at the Star Tribune. Art was a loving & devoted son staying at his parents' sides until they passed. Art married the love of his life Doris Ratzlaff in 1987. They took up an active life participating in bowling leagues with many friends. Doris kept Art's mind alert with a spirited and, at times, nagging, nudge and banter. Art remained dedicated at Doris' side until her death in 2007. In recent years, Art enjoyed living in his home in Apple Valley, cared for lovingly by stepdaughter, Judy Ratzlaff, her son Kenny, and Daisy, his constant companion & lapdog. Thanks to granddaughter, Jondah too, for her help near the end. Preceded in death by parents, Arthur & Esther; wife, Doris; sister, Shirley Peterson; brother, Elroy and stepson, Jeffrey. Survived by stepchildren: Harvey (Karen), Maggie Teal, Jan Jensen, Judy, Chuck, Kris (Deb) and Denise Ratzlaff; sister-in-law, Elaine Blomquist; niece & nephews: Sharon, Karl Blomquist; Lyn (Becky), Lon & Lorin Peterson; and special friend, Harold "Red" Sweet.
